Allele Information
Allele:
Ghrhtm1.1(cre)Mgmj
growth hormone releasing hormone; targeted mutation 1.1, Martin G Myers, Jr
Driver: Ghrh
Type: Targeted (Recombinase)
Synonym: GhrhCre
Molecular description: A targeting construct was designed to replace the stop codon of the growth hormone releasing hormone (Ghrh) gene with a viral P2A oligopeptide, from porcine teschovirus-1, fused to a Cre recombinase gene. A frt-flanked neomycin resistance (neo) cassette inserted downstream. The construct was electroporated into R1 embryonic stem (ES) cells. Correctly targeted ES cells were injected into blastocysts and resulting chimeric mice were bred with B6.129S4-Gt(ROSA)26Sor/J mice to remove the neo cassette.
